/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Thrilling Casino Adventures: Unlock the Ultimate Gaming Experience

Thrilling Casino Adventures: Unlock the Ultimate Gaming Experience

Thrilling Casino Adventures: Unlock the Ultimate Gaming Experience

Discover the World of Casino Excitement

Step into the mesmerizing world of casinos where every spin of the wheel and flip of the card carries the promise of thrill and fortune. The allure of casinos lies in their ability to provide an escape from the mundane, transporting players into a universe where anything is possible. From the dazzling lights of Las Vegas to the online platforms that bring games right to your fingertips, the casino experience is one that is full of excitement and adventure waiting to be unlocked. Whether you're a seasoned gambler or a curious newcomer, there's a unique thrill waiting for everyone who steps into this vibrant domain.

Online platforms, such as glitter-bingo-casino.co.uk, have revolutionized the way we engage with casino games. They offer an array of gaming options that cater to various tastes and preferences, providing a convenient and accessible venue for both casual and serious players. With a wide selection of games, ranging from classic slots to engaging bingo themes, this site ensures that every player's experience is personalized and unforgettable. The convenience of playing from home, coupled with the excitement that these casino games bring, guarantees an unparalleled gaming adventure that will keep you coming back for more.

The Essential Casino Games You Must Try

When you dive into the casino universe, certain games stand out for their popularity and the unique experiences they offer. Slot machines, with their vibrant themes and dynamic gameplay, are often the first choice for many. Their simplicity and the promise of winning big with a single spin make them irresistible to both new players and seasoned veterans. Meanwhile, table games like poker and blackjack test your strategic skills and offer interactive play that can lead to rewarding wins. Each game provides a different thrill, ensuring that there's always something to match everyone's taste.

Glitter Bingo Casino brings such experiences right to you with its vast selection of offerings. This platform doesn't just stop at traditional tables and slots; it extends to various themed bingo games that add a new dimension to your gaming regimen. These games have the ability to transport players to different worlds, combining the classic elements of bingo with modern twists and innovations. Whether you prefer playing alone or engaging with a lively community, this site creates a vibrant environment where fun and excitement are always in abundance.

The Magic of Live Casino Experiences

In the realm of online gaming, live casinos deliver experiences that are second to none. These platforms incorporate real dealers and authentic casino settings through high-definition streaming, bridging the gap between virtual and physical casino worlds. Playing live games allows participants to engage in real-time, providing an atmosphere that closely replicates the excitement of being in a live casino. The interactive nature of these games invites more personal connections and can enhance the overall enjoyment of your gaming adventure.

Imagine the delight of engaging with a dealer, alongside other participants, from the comfort of your own home. Glitter Bingo Casino enhances these experiences by offering a broad range of live game options, ensuring that there’s something to capture every player's interest. From live blackjack tables to exclusive bingo rooms, you can explore a plethora of live gaming avenues that bring the true essence of a casino right to your screen. The richness of these live adventures creates a dynamic, real-time gaming journey, one that is as close to reality as possible.

Experience Unmatched Thrills with Glitter Bingo Casino

For those craving a diverse and exciting online gaming experience, Glitter Bingo Casino is an unparalleled choice. Known for its vibrant selection of games and user-friendly interface, this site has become a favorite among enthusiasts who seek adventure in every session. The commitment to providing top-notch security and fairness in every game ensures that players can immerse themselves in the experience without concerns, focusing solely on enjoying the rush of adrenaline and potential rewards.

Glitter Bingo Casino continues to innovate and expand its offerings, ensuring it remains at the forefront of the online gaming industry. With new games frequently added and a community-driven environment that encourages interaction and engagement, this platform is more than just a gaming site; it's a vibrant community that celebrates every win, big or small. Whether you visit for the epic slots, thrilling bingo themes, or the engaging live casino atmosphere, you are guaranteed an ultimate gaming experience that enthralls and entertains. Discover the thrilling possibilities that await and dive into an adventure that promises excitement at every turn.